Meat, Poultry, and Fish Cutters and Trimmers

SOC 51-3022 • View wages by state

The median annual wage for Meat, Poultry, and Fish Cutters and Trimmers is $36,300, based on BLS OEWS 2023 data. The mean annual wage is $36,840, and an estimated 138,300 workers are employed in this occupation nationally. Between 2020 and 2023, pay rose +20.2% while consumer prices rose 17.7% — a real change of +2.1% after inflation. BLS projects employment will grow 5.5% between 2024 and 2034.
